In the stomach and especially in the small intestine, digestive enzymes work to break down the large collagen proteins. This enzymatic action cleaves the protein chains into smaller units: peptides and individual amino acids. It's these smaller fragments, particularly the di- and tripeptides, that are readily absorbed.

Research published in journals like the *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ry* and *Nutrients* has demonstrated that oral administration of collagen hydrolysate (CH) leads to the presence of these smaller peptides and amino acids in the bloodstream. How Efficient is Collagen Peptide Absorption?

The efficiency of collagen peptide absorption is a significant area of scientific interest. While some studies suggest that native collagen is resistant to enzymatic cleavage, resulting in poor absorption (as low as ~10%), hydrolyzed collagen and its peptides fare much better.

The size of the collagen peptides plays a critical role in their bioavailability and how well they are absorbedCollagen benefits: Should I take a supplement?. Hydrolyzed collagen peptides are typically around 10,000 daltons, which is considerably smaller than intact collagen. Beyond Absorption: What Happens Next?

Once absorbed through the small intestine, these collagen peptides and amino acids enter the bloodstream.Collagen and Your Body: What to Know From there, they are transported via the circulatory system to various tissues throughout the bodyDoes Collagen Survive Stomach Acid?. It's here that the magic truly happens. These absorbed fragments are believed to act as building blocks and signaling molecules, potentially stimulating the body's own natural collagen production.

While the body doesn't absorb collagen directly into your skin or joints, the systemic delivery of these peptides allows them to reach connective tissues. The scientific literature suggests that tripeptides derived from collagen are absorbed efficiently by the body, supporting this concept.
